‘Final Destination: Bloodlines’ brings back the core concept of the franchise: ordinary objects becoming instruments of death through a series of improbable events. This installment distinguishes itself with a dose of humor and self-awareness, acknowledging the absurdity of its premise.
The film opens with a disaster in 1969, setting the stage for a present-day college student, Stefani, to uncover a family secret: her grandmother survived the initial incident but inadvertently marked her descendants for death. This leads to a series of creative and gruesome scenarios as Death comes for those who cheated fate. One of the standout aspects of 'Bloodlines' is its handling of Tony Todd's character, William Bludworth. Knowing that this would likely be Todd's last film, the directors crafted a scene allowing him to impart wisdom and bid farewell to fans. This not only provides closure for the character but also serves as a touching tribute to the actor.
'Final Destination: Bloodlines' also addresses a long-standing mystery in the series, explaining Bludworth's expertise on death. The revelation that he cheated death himself adds depth to his character and provides a logical explanation for his knowledge.
